National Engineers Week

Since 1951, National Engineers Week has been recognized in the United States by companies, organizations, and various government agencies. Each year it falls the week in February that includes February 22nd, which is George Washington’s birthday. The reason it is associated with Washington’s birthday is because he is viewed as the country’s first engineer due… Continue reading National Engineers Week

Girls Garage

Looking for a summer camp to attend this year? If so, check out Girls Garage. Girls Garage is a design and building workshop specifically created for girls. This nonprofit organization provides free and low-cost programs that focus on technical skills, college and career guidance, and leadership. Their mission is to help girls build the world… Continue reading Girls Garage

Utah STEM Action Center

The Utah STEM Action Center is Utah's leader in promotion science, technology, engineering, and math. They provide resources to parents, students, and teachers to help prioritize STEM education to develop Utah’s workforce of the future. The STEM Action Center Board uses legislative funding to oversee projects that will spark students' imagination and creativity in STEM… Continue reading Utah STEM Action Center
